What Are Payouts and Why They Matter

Payouts are the distribution of funds from a business, investment, or service to stakeholders, customers, or employees. Whether in finance, gaming, or e-commerce, effective payout management ensures trust, compliance, and profitability. For businesses, payout optimization directly impacts cash flow and customer satisfaction, making it a critical component of long-term financial strategies. Understanding the types of payouts and their processing methods is the first step toward streamlining operations and maximizing returns.

Types of Payouts in Modern Finance

  • Direct Transfers: Instant bank transfers for payroll, vendor payments, or investment returns.
  • Cashback Rewards: Refunds or incentives distributed to customers through loyalty programs.
  • Dividends: Profit-sharing distributions to shareholders in publicly traded companies.

Legal and Tax Considerations for Payouts

Compliance is non-negotiable in payout management. Businesses must account for tax implications, such as withholding requirements for international payouts, and adhere to anti-money laundering (AML) regulations. Clear documentation of types of payouts and their processing methods is essential for audits and legal defense. Consulting legal experts ensures that financial strategies align with evolving laws.

Technology Tools for Streamlining Payouts

  • Payment Gateways: Platforms like Stripe or PayPal for secure and scalable payout processing.
  • ERP Systems: Enterprise resource planning software to integrate payouts with accounting and HR modules.
  • Blockchain Solutions: Transparent and tamper-proof payout systems for high-security use cases.
